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人

CSSでデスクトップアプリを作ろう JavaScript HTML

Add: usytijyx3 - Date: 2020-11-24 03:26:11 - Views: 7427 - Clicks: 2481

Connecting Python 3 and Electron/Node. 今回は、HTML5とJavaScriptを使ったスマホアプリの開発方法をご紹介します。 これらの言語はすでにホームページを作成したことがある人であれば基本的な知識を押さえているので、スマホアプリを開発するときにもそれほど学習コストがかかりません。. Not to mention it is still fine once sanitized.

js에 익숙한 분들은 쉽게 접근이 가능합니다. Most of the events in Electron live on the app object. Electron apps make use of a main process running Node. &0183;&32;Electron Apps: The Best Software Framework for Cross-Platform Compatibility? Try, learn and explore Electron JS! Electron is built upon Node and as you may know, Node prides itself upon being “an asynchronous event-driven JavaScript runtime”.

Visual Studio CodeでJavaScriptをデバッグ. Он берет на себя все сложности создания десктопных. At most it merits a small note at the end saying "btw: if it's user input make sure to sanitize first or use X method that doesn't need it".

Electron uses a Node. click イベントはマウスのカーソルが要素の上にある状態で、マウスが押されたあとで離された時に発生するイベントです。 onclick 属性または onclick プロパティに対してイベントハンドラを設定したり、 addEventListener メソッドの引数として click を指定してイベントリスナーを登録できます。. Microsoftから提供されているエディタVisual Studio Code(VSCode)は、デバッグ機能を備えていて対象言語のデバッグ用拡張機能を追加するだけでデバッグができるようになります。. Initially developed for GitHub's Atom editor, Electron has since been used to create applications by companies like Microsoft, Facebook, Slack, and Docker. There is one other important thing to do to make your app ready for end users. 」 - ITmedia NEWS. JavaScript, Vue votedon. Also if you want to use angular, react, vue or any other framework or library, you will need to manually configure for that.

Electron native modules - Shell which provides APIs for desktop related tasks, in our case opening a URL in the default web browser. js and Electron with simple examples. Webサイトを作成する感覚でデスクトップアプリを開発できます。Electron は JavaScript, HTML, CSS といったWeb技術を利用してネイティブアプリケーションを作成するためのフレームワークです。開発者はアプリの重要な部分の実装に集中して、面倒な. js&174; is a JavaScript runtime built on Chrome's V8 JavaScript engine. The desktop apps built with Electron JS can be easily packaged for Mac, Linux or Windows. React JS: React makes it painless to create interactive UIs.

What Are Electron apps? Neutralinojs offers a lightweight and portable SDK which is 野口将人 an alternative for Electron and NW. Electron is a framework for creating native applications with web technologies like JavaScript, HTML, and CSS. Learn to code for free.

We’ll introduce Electron for Python developers, a great tool if you want to build GUIs for your Python apps with modern web technologies. Electron은 JavaScript, HTML, CSS 같은 웹 기술로 네이티브 애플리케이션을 만들 수 있는 프레임워크입니다. It takes care of the hard parts so you can focus on the core of your application. In electron and NWjs you have to install NodeJs and hundreds of dependency libraries. The element has a single, well-defined purpose — to create a line break in a block of text. Electron 은 "Web Technologies" 을 통해 Native Desktop App 을 만드는 기술입니다. You need to package it into an.

jsのパッケージを管理するツール(npm: Node Package Manager)が使用できます。 npmを使ってelectronをインストールします。 npm install -g electron Electronがインストールされたことを確認します。 npm list -g electron. 1 htmlテンプレートとは?2 htmlテンプレートで基本的な書き方(雛形コード)3 テンプレートを選ぶ際のポイント4 htmlテンプレートのおすすめをタイプ別に紹介5 まとめhtmlテンプレートとは?htmlテンプレートとは、htmlや. Use bibisco to develop characters, design novel structure, organize chapters and scenes. Electron 「Electron」は、JavaScript/HTML/CSSを使用してクロスプラットフォームなデスクトップアプリを作るためのエンジンです.

js and Chromium that enables us to build desktop applications using standard web technologies like HTML, CSS and, of course, JavaScript. This article that is going to to mainly focus on sizing article specific content. If you can build a website, you can build a desktop app.

js를 이용하고 있으며, 이에 따라 Node. See some of our Electron. After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人 running this command you will. If you take a peak into the sources of torchie you will find a more advanced event manager system. こんにちは、ライターのマサトです! JavaScriptの開発に欠かせないのは、書いたプログラムを実行する環境ですね。 しかしいざ実行しよう!と思っても、 どのように実行するのかわからない. And with this our app is ready! js | Aplicaci&243;n de Enlaces con Async/Await y localstorage 1238 tutorial Actualizado: hace 1 a&241;o. Electron Combines Chromium and NodeJS into a single Runtime.

Ap | 12 Minute Read. js also with many advantages. I'm currently working on a frameless application with ElectronJS where I'm trying to have a parent window handle the dragging, minimize, maximize, and exit, as well as a controller for the child window which will handle all of the content.

Packaging and Distribution. pretty README as service. Electron can read arbitrary files from it without unpacking the whole file. Electron(JavaScript/HTML/CSS) Webドキュメントもあります。 Hugo. Design simple views for.

Now that we have our Vuejs application up and running we need to add the electron-builder package to our Vue application. สวัสดีคร๊าบบบ วันนี้เราจะมาคุยกันเรื่อง “Electron” กันครับ เรื่องของเรื่องมีอยู่ว่า เพื่อนผมคนนึงมาปรึกษาว่าอยากจะเขียน Desktop App ด้วย Electron ไอ้เราก็. You can set a margin on elements themselves to increase the spacing between the lines of text in the block, but this is a bad practice — you should use the line-height property that. Devtron – it is the official Electronではじめるアプリ開発 DevTools extension. 당신이 애플리케이션 개발에만 집중할 수 있도록 어려운 부분을 대신합니다.

Electron 은 JavaScript, HTML, CSS 같은 웹 기술로 네이티브 애플리케이션을 만드는 프레임워크입니다. As such, it has no dimensions or visual output of its own, and there is very little you can do to style it. js and a renderer process running the Chromium. Electron follows the same pattern — it’s heavily event based.

其中我们最熟悉的和使用的Atom和VsCode编辑器就是基于Electron实现的. In this post, you’ll learn about the possible ways that you can use to connect or integrate Python with Node. 米GitHubのアプリケーション構築フレームワーク「Electron」開発チームは7月7日、最新版となる「Electron 9. To add this package to our application run this on the terminal: vue add electron-builder.

Introducci&243;n a Electron Tu primer Aplicaci&243;n de Escritorio 2524 tutorial Actualizado: hac. If you can build a website, you will be able to build cross. Electron is an open source framework that lets developers build pseudo-native applications using familiar web technologies (JavaScript, HTML, CSS). ElectronとWebAssemblyとBlazorの違いがよくわかっていないので、JS関連の学習を始めるきっかけとして整理してみる。 Windows 以外のOS(MacやLinuxなど)でも利用できるようにしたいとか、今でも超現役の Windows Forms の代替っぽいものがほしいとか、クロスプラットフォームでデスクトップ. yep, i have worked with electron for about 4 years now.

If Electron is used directly, then some manual setup is needed before building your application. you would think multi windows would be easy but its actual quite hard. Calling Electron APIs from Angular. 在开始之前,我想您一定会有这样的困惑:标题里的Electron 是什么?Electron能做什么?许多伟大的公司使用Electron框架的原因又是什么? 带着这些问题和疑惑,通过本文的介绍,可助您全面地认识Electron这. Electron - это фреймворк, разработанный в GitHub, для создания нативных десктопных приложений, используя веб-технологии, такие как JavaScript, HTML и CSS.

It will use a lot of Flexbox, and will look at a effective ways of make a web site screen size adjustable by. Embedded Chromium and Node creates large overhead and makes even simple apps like “hello world” considerable in size. If you click the save button, your code will be saved, and you get a URL you can share with others. This page defines some terminology that is commonly used in Electron development. Este video es un ejemplo pr&225;ctico de Electronjs, una plataforma que nos permite desarrollar desktop apps o aplicaciones de escritorio usando Tecnolog&237;a web, como HTML, CSS, Javascript, y Nodejs. Let’s now see how we can call Electron APIs from Angular. each window has its own sandbox so you need to use some fancy event arch to communitcate.

This enables Us to run the HTML, CSS and Javascript Code as a desktop application. clipboard-manager-electron Simple clipboard manager with unlimited history in IndexedDB. Electron JS is a framework based on Node. 0が、11月17日に公開された。「Electron」は、GitHub社が開発したオープンソースのGUI. React Phone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人 E-Commerce ProjectSETUP Electron-compile – it uses ES, CoffeeScript, LESS, SCSS in your app without a pre-compilation step. JS: Building Modern Desktop Apps. Build cross JavaScript/HTML/CSSでデスクトップアプリを作ろう platform desktop apps with JavaScript, HTML, and CSS. The question says nothing about user input, so a blanket statement that innerHTML is not recommended is ridiculous.

An asar archive is a simple tar-like format that concatenates files into a single file. Spectron – it tests Electron apps using ChromeDriver. Electron是一个能让你使用传统前端技术(Nodejs, Javascript, HTML, CSS)开发一个跨平台桌面应用的框架。这里所说的桌面应用指的是在Windows、OSX及Linux系统上运行的程序。 也就是说electron他是开发桌面应用程序,可以兼容window、osx、Liunx.

With Electron, creating a desktop application for your company or idea is easy. I used HTML5 file input with attribute like validation etc, As you can see file upload input field is a required field and allows to choose CSV formatted file. The Electron framework lets you write cross-platform desktop applications using JavaScript, HTML and CSS. 기본적으로 Chromium과 Node. The idea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人 that one should sanitize user input is SO NOT RELATED to this specific question.

Not familiar with Electron? ASAR stands for Atom Shell Archive Format. 被災地支援のためのマストドン研究会 マストドン連携ログイン機能を設計. It's easier than you think. Electron: If you can build a website, you can build a desktop app.

This helps to package and build a ready for distribution Electron app for macOS, Windows, and Linux with “auto-update” support out of the box. js modules - OS for accessing system memory information, Pretty Bytes for formatting. Allow me to introduce you. With the smartphone taking prominence in a bold, new, “Post-PC era”, there’s been a steady decline in the desktop user base, and things are not getting any better with the.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ML.

Every Electron app has exactly one main process aka “browser process”. 0」を公開した。 Electronは、Node. I also have a lot of work into making multiple window apps with IPC routing. Electron-packager – it packages the files and distributes in your app.

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人

email: fovyfaf@gmail.com - phone:(305) 599-4942 x 4913

大市民 人生は酒と女と割りきるべし!編 - 柳沢きみお - 歳のちえ

-> 闇の通い路 - 永井路子
->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人

Electronではじめるアプリ開発 JavaScript/HTML/CSSでデスクトップアプリを作ろう - 野口将人 - 混声合唱曲 中田喜直 中田喜直

Sitemap 1

金融工学とは何か - 刈屋武昭 - ポケット女子アナ Best 女子アナ研究会